Transaction 36f3c636fbec7c669b29a76efa76cf723181ecb4d8521a092787f1984e0bc020
1 Input
1 Output
-
36f3c636fbec7c669b29a76efa76cf723181ecb4d8521a092787f1984e0bc020:0
- value
- 25401569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a4f8e42b2b2aede4e4de4f516f546eae16b4fb9 OP_EQUAL
- address
- 3CqjfaGSCDAJ8NUGaeBEdbVhePuu73Wdc6